How to Find a Reliable Real Estate Agent in a New City

A good agent can make the home-buying or renting process smoother and more efficient. Here are some steps to help you find a trustworthy real estate agent in your new location.

1. Research Online: Start by conducting online research to identify real estate agents in your new city. Websites like Zillow, Realtor.com, and Redfin provide listings of agents along with their ratings and reviews. Look for agents with positive feedback and a solid track record in the area you’re interested in. Pay attention to their specialties, such as residential, commercial, or rental properties, to ensure they align with your needs.

2. Seek Recommendations: Ask friends, family, or colleagues if they know any real estate agents in the city. Personal recommendations can provide insights into an agent’s professionalism and reliability. If you’re moving for work, consider reaching out to your new employer or colleagues for referrals, as they may have experience with local agents.

3. Check Credentials and Experience: Once you have a list of potential agents, verify their credentials. Ensure they are licensed and have relevant certifications, such as being a member of the National Association of Realtors (NAR). Look for agents with extensive experience in the local market, as they will have a better understanding of neighborhood trends, pricing, and available properties.

4. Interview Multiple Agents: Don’t settle for the first agent you meet. Schedule interviews with at least three agents to discuss your needs and gauge their responses. Ask about their experience in the area, their approach to buying or selling homes, and how they plan to help you achieve your goals. Pay attention to their communication style and whether they seem genuinely interested in helping you.

5. Assess Local Market Knowledge: A reliable agent should demonstrate a deep understanding of the local market. During your interviews, ask specific questions about neighborhoods, property values, and market trends. A knowledgeable agent can provide valuable insights that will help you make informed decisions.

6. Review Their Current Listings: Take a look at the agent’s current listings to assess their style and the types of properties they handle. This can give you an idea of whether their expertise aligns with what you are looking for. Additionally, check how quickly their properties are selling and how they are marketed.

7. Trust Your Instincts: After meeting with several agents, trust your instincts. Choose someone you feel comfortable with and who listens to your needs. A good agent should be approachable, responsive, and willing to advocate for you throughout the process.

8. Read the Fine Print: Before signing any agreements, carefully read the terms of the contract with your chosen agent. Understand their commission structure, any fees involved, and the duration of the agreement. Ensure that you are clear about your expectations and their obligations.

In conclusion, finding a reliable real estate agent in a new city requires thorough research, personal recommendations, and careful evaluation of candidates. By following these steps, you can secure an agent who will help you navigate the complexities of the real estate market and find the perfect home in your new city.
